Transaction 421f056883381e8b08b2f38351ad39742942c83313440b7c4d94a1d797f44e78

3 Input
2 Outputs
  • 421f056883381e8b08b2f38351ad39742942c83313440b7c4d94a1d797f44e78:0
  • value  28224
    address  19dpZs7vN8XvCn64DBUbt7CPsdiL4h4vnp
  • 421f056883381e8b08b2f38351ad39742942c83313440b7c4d94a1d797f44e78:1
  • value  530660
    address  34LM4wczQe84fveisrnvNVqrTvHtwpwKTw